Alaska Supreme Court

Bobbie Ann Hunter, Appellant v. Shaun T. Conwell, Appellee

April 13, 20122012 Alas. LEXIS 59

Summary

The Alaska Supreme Court affirmed the denial of Hunter's motion to modify custody. It held that the evidence did not establish a substantial change in circumstances concerning alleged verbal abuse, the children's behavior, Conwell's work-related travel, or telephonic visitation. Because Hunter failed to satisfy that threshold requirement, the superior court was not required to conduct a best-interests analysis.
